Prevalence of mastitis in Algerian dromedary camels and antimicrobial resistance of the causative Staphylococci
To investigate the prevalence, bacterial spectrum of mastitis, and antimicrobial resistance of the causative staphylococci in Algerian dromedary camels, a total of 200 lactating camels were first examined for clinical mastitis and the healthy quarters were examined for subclinical mastitis using the...
